Preheat oven to 375.
2
In large mixing bowl pour warm tea.
3
Add sugar and brown sugar to the tea mixture.
4
Stir until sugar dissolves.
5
In a separate bowl combine flour, baking soda, nutmeg and cloves.
6
Add butter to the bowl with with sugar and tea mixture.
7
Stir the butter, sugar and tea mixture until thoroughly blended (mixture may not look creamy because of water and butter).
8
Slowly add while stirring the flour mixture to the wet ingredients.
9
Stir until all flour is mixed in and the mixture is creamy.
10
Add almonds, pistacios and chocolate (optional) and stir until blended into the mixture.
11
Spoon heaping teaspoons of the cookie dough on to an ungreased cookie sheet aproximately 1 inch a part from each other.
12
Bake at 375 for 10 to 12 minutes (golden brown and firm).
13
Enjoy!
